Job description

  • You define design standards and UI/UX strategies for complex enterprise applications (web, touch, mobile).
  • You conduct user research in the field and in industrial environments and optimize the user guidance of our products.
  • You develop personas, user journeys, prototypes, and wireframes.
  • You work closely with product management, development, and international design teams.
  • You present design concepts to customers and management.
  • You support customer workshops and requirements analyses.
